On September 18, Princess Marie of Denmark opened the exhibition "The Golden Age of Danish Painting" (L'Âge d'or de la peinture danoise) at the Petit Palais in Paris, France. At the exhibition “The Golden Age of Danish Painting”, more than 200 works by Denmark's leading artists in the period from 1801 to 1864 are being displayed.
The exhibition is organized jointly by the Statens Museum for Kunst (SMK) in Copenhagen and the Nationalmuseum of Stockholm. Inspired by new forms of architecture that emerged after the Copenhagen fire of 1795, between 1800-1864, Danish painting entered its golden age as artists started painting scenes from everyday life in greater detail than ever before.
